您好,欢迎访问三七文档
当前位置:首页 > 行业资料 > 其它行业文档 > 虚拟机技术简介和VMware虚拟机使用
XbrotherTechnologyCo.,LTD.虚拟机技术发展史从早期的概念的虚拟机出现,到现代x86虚拟机的流行,虚拟机技术已经有几十年的历史了。早在上个世纪七十年代,IBM研究中心就在试验室里实现了其主机的镜像,算是最原始的虚拟机了。40多年来,虚拟机一直在大型机和小型机中运行,无声无息。直到有一天,vmware将x86虚拟机带到了人们的面前。当我们在Linux中打开一个独立的虚拟机系统,看到了熟悉的Windows的蓝天和白云时,人们才真正意识到虚拟技术已经发展到这样的一个阶段,而且是这样的诱人。近年来,虚拟机技术已经逐渐成为人们关注的热点,正受到越来越多的关注和重视,如VMware已经被80%以上的全球百强企业所采纳。随着多年来研究的深入,虚拟机技术已经在企业计算、灾难恢复、分布式计算和系统安全领域得到了广泛应用。XbrotherTechnologyCo.,LTD.虚拟机技术发展史应用相关的架构层Exchange文件/打印WebCRMBI商务应用App1App2App3App4关键指标资产利用率运营费用高可用/容灾计划覆盖数据中心扩展的努力资源配置/移动/变更123456数周$-百万时间:数月/数年10%覆盖~$4,000/服务器/年20%%花费(维护对创新)72%/28%传统数据中心架构面临的挑战XbrotherTechnologyCo.,LTD.虚拟机技术发展史市场进化的趋势Virtualization存储服务器虚拟化2000年–现在虚拟化(服务器虚拟化、存储虚拟化、网络虚拟化)Intel架构服务器UNIX服务器网络存储客户端/服务器和服务器整合80年代中期–90年代70年代–80年代早期大机年代XbrotherTechnologyCo.,LTD.虚拟机技术发展史虚拟化的关键特征硬件独立可以在其他服务器上不加修改的运行虚拟机兼容性虚拟机完全兼容标准的操作系统,以及在这些操作系统之上建立的硬件驱动和应用隔离每一个虚拟机都与同在一个服务器上的其他虚拟机相隔离封装虚拟机将整个系统,包括硬件配置、操作系以及应用等封装在文件里…………...………………...………………...……XbrotherTechnologyCo.,LTD.虚拟机技术发展史支持企业级的负载在虚拟机中已经可以运行资源消耗巨大的企业级应用,如数据库、CRM、ERP应用。单个虚拟机最大可支持64GBRAM,最多4个虚拟CPU支持最强大的物理服务器(32个逻辑CPU和256GBRAM)每台ESXServer最多可以支持到128个虚拟机同时运行XbrotherTechnologyCo.,LTD.虚拟机技术分类目前,主流的x86虚拟机技术主要有这样几类:1.虚拟硬件模式2.虚拟操作系统模式3.XenXbrotherTechnologyCo.,LTD.硬件虚拟模式虚拟硬件模式是最传统的虚拟计算机模式。最早的虚拟硬件模式当然是源自IBM大型机的逻辑分区技术。这种技术的主要特点是,每一个虚拟机都是一台真正机器的完整拷贝,一个功能强大的主机可以被分割成许多虚拟机。目前,这一虚拟模式被业界广泛借鉴,包括HPvPAR、VMwareESXServer和Xen在内的虚拟技术都是这样的工作原理。虚拟硬件模型将计算机、存储和网络硬件间建立了一个抽象的虚拟化平台,使得所有的硬件被统一到一个虚拟化层中。这样,在这个平台的顶部创建的虚拟机具有同样的硬件结构,提供了更好的可迁移性。在这种模型中,每个用户都可以在他们的虚拟机上运行程序、存储数据,甚至虚拟机崩溃也不会影响系统本身和其他的系统用户。所以,虚拟机模型不仅允许资源共享,而且实现了系统资源的保护。简介XbrotherTechnologyCo.,LTD.硬件虚拟模式目前,此类虚拟机的典型产品有:1、Vmware的Workstation、GSXServer、ESXServer2、Microsoft的VirtualPC、VirtualServer3、Parallels的Workstation以上的几种虚拟机软件都具有同样的特点:虚拟了Intelx86平台,可以同时运行多个操作系统和应用程序。通过使用虚拟化层,提供了硬件级的虚拟,即虚拟机为运行于虚拟机的操作系统映像提供了一整套虚拟的Intelx86兼容硬件。这套虚拟硬件虚拟了真正服务器所拥有的全部设备:主板芯片、CPU、内存、SCSI和IDE磁盘设备、各种接口、显示和其他输入输出设备。并且,每个虚拟机都可以被独立的封装到一个文件中,可以实现虚拟机的灵活迁移。主流软件XbrotherTechnologyCo.,LTD.硬件虚拟模式对于VMware来说,该公司提供了从工作站版本到服务器版本,从迁移工具到管理工具的一系列产品,形成了一整套的解决方案。作为这个行业的领头羊,Vmware仍然具有比较大的技术优势。但是,该公司一个比较大的问题是价格问题。虽然,Vmware公司已经推出了多个免费版本的产品,但是Vmware核心的企业级产品ESXServer不是免费的,而且价格不腓。然而,对于真正虚需要使用该产品的用户们来说,价格也许并不成问题。VmwareXbrotherTechnologyCo.,LTD.硬件虚拟模式作为虚拟机技术领域的“第二号人物”,微软这几年的脚步有些慢。在推出了VirtualPC2004之后,虽然推出了服务器级产品VirtualServer2005。但VirtualServer2005并没有什么过人的优势,功能上能与VMwareGSXServer进行竞争,但迫于市场的压力,VirtualServer2005已经免费了。在这个虚拟化火爆的年代,相信微软也不会放过虚拟机这块肥肉的,让我们拭目以待吧。MicrosoftXbrotherTechnologyCo.,LTD.硬件虚拟模式Parallels是虚拟机技术领域的后起之秀,目前只有工作站级产品,但是其推出的MACOS版本的产品已经在网上炒的沸沸扬扬。ParallelsWorkstation具有和VmwareWorkstation类似的界面和功能,虽然在技术上和VmwareWorkstation相比并不占优势,但其最大的诱人之处在于极其低廉的价格。ParallelsXbrotherTechnologyCo.,LTD.硬件虚拟模式硬件虚拟技术有两个显著特点。第一,无论哪款产品,都可以直接用系统处理器执行CPU指令,根本涉及不到虚拟层。第二,实现真正的分区隔离,每个分区只能占用一定的系统资源,包括磁盘I/O和网络带宽,并提高了系统的整体安全性。另外,高端的虚拟服务器产品可以直接在硬件上运行虚拟机,而不需要宿主操作系统。并且,通过相关的管理软件,可以对每个虚拟机消耗的物理资源(网络带宽、磁盘I/O访问等)进行精确的控制。特点XbrotherTechnologyCo.,LTD.虚拟操作系统模式虚拟操作系统模型是基于虚拟机运行的主机操作系统创建了一个虚拟层,用来虚拟机主机的操作系统。在这个虚拟层之上,可以创建多个相互隔离的虚拟专用服务器(VirtualPrivateServer,VPS)。这些VPS可以最大化的效率共享硬件、软件许可证以及管理资源。对其用户和应用程序来讲,每一个VPS平台的运行和管理都与一台独立主机完全相同,因为每一个VPS均可独立进行重启并拥有自己的root访问权限、用户、IP地址、内存、过程、文件、应用程序、系统函数库以及配置文件。对于运行着多个应用程序和拥有实际数据的产品服务器来说,虚拟操作系统的虚拟机可以降低成本消耗和提高系统效率。简介XbrotherTechnologyCo.,LTD.虚拟操作系统模式虚拟操作系统模式虚拟化解决方案同样能够满足一系列的需求:安全隔离、计算机资源的灵活性和控制、硬件抽象操作及最终高效、强大的管理功能。每一个VPS中的应用服务都是安全隔离的,且不受同一物理服务器上的其他VPS的影响。通过专用的文件系统,使得文件浏览对所有VPS用户来说就如常规服务器一样,但却无法被该服务器上的其他VPS用户看到。能够实时分配、监控、计算并控制资源级别,完成对CPU、内存、网络输入/输出、磁盘空间以及其他网络资源的灵活管理。经过抽象的VPS具有相同的虚拟硬件结构,并可以在任意连网的服务器之间透明迁移,而不产生任何宕机时间。特点XbrotherTechnologyCo.,LTD.虚拟操作系统模式操作系统虚拟化技术解决了在单个物理服务器上部署多个生产应用服务和存储服务器时所面临的挑战。在应用服务部署完成之后,它们被集中于同一种操作系统以便于管理和维护。操作系统虚拟化是针对生产应用和服务器的完美虚拟化解决方案,共享的操作系统提供了更为有效的服务器资源并且大大降低了处理损耗。通过操作系统虚拟化,上百个VPS可以在单个的物理服务器上正常运行。但同时,这种集中于同一操作系统的特性也注定了该类虚拟机只能在同一台物理服务器上运行同一种虚拟的操作系统。也许,你将拥有一台同时运行100个windows或linux虚拟机的高性能服务器,但你不要想在这一服务器上同时运行虚拟的windows和linux系统。目前,swsoft的virtuozzo是这一领域的成熟产品。XbrotherTechnologyCo.,LTD.Xen在不断增加的虚拟化技术列表中,Xen是近来最引人注目的技术之一。Xen是在剑桥大学作为一个研究项目被开发出来的,它已经在开源社区中得到了极大的推动。Xen是一款半虚拟化(paravirtualizing)VMM(虚拟机监视器,VirtualMachineMonitor),这表示,为了调用系统管理程序,要有选择地修改操作系统,然而却不需要修改操作系统上运行的应用程序。Xen是一种特殊的虚拟硬件虚拟机,具有虚拟硬件虚拟机的大部分特性,其最大的不同点在于,Xen需要修改操作系统内核。目前,Xen只支持在Linux系统之上实现的Linux虚拟机。不过,其新的版本将支持Intel公司的硬件虚拟技术Intel-VT,这一个关键技术将可以用以解决Xen在虚拟化Windows系统方面的困难。VMware仍然是虚拟技术领域的领袖,在产品的成熟度方面它比XenSource公司还是有着很明显的优势。但是很多的业内人士认为,由于开源的原因,Xen的实力将会越来越强。XbrotherTechnologyCo.,LTD.Vmware安装windows2003系统VMware产品介绍VMware最著名的产品为ESX,安装在裸服务器上的强大server,最近系列产品升级,更名为vSphere系列,最新产品为vSphere5.0。是VMware的企业级产品,该产品一直遥遥领先于微软Hyper-V跟思杰Xen。是构建大企业数据中心的不二之选,目前中国很大一部分商业银行,保险公司,电信公司以及政府部门都在使用。其架构也是云计算的底层。VMware第二大产品为:VMwareWorkstation虚拟机是一个在Windows或Linux计算机上运行的应用程序,它可以模拟一个基于x86的标准PC环境。这个环境和真实的计算机一样,都有芯片组、CPU、内存、显卡、声卡、网卡、软驱、硬盘、光驱、串口、并口、USB控制器、SCSI控制器等设备,提供这个应用程序的窗口就是虚拟机的显示器。每个虚拟机实例可以运行其自己的客户机操作系统,如Windows、Linux、BSD衍生版本。用简单术语来描述就是,VMware工作站允许一台真实的计算机同时运行数个操作系统。VMwareworkstation9.0已经于2012年8月27日发布,支持微软的最新操作系统windows8。XbrotherTechnologyCo.,LTD.Vmware安装windows2003系统1.安装虚拟机2.安装Windows2003虚拟操作系统3.配置Windows2003虚拟操作系统XbrotherTechnologyCo.,LTD.安装虚拟机解压VMware.Workstation.v8.0.1.528992.Incl.Keymaker-ZWT
本文标题:虚拟机技术简介和VMware虚拟机使用
链接地址:https://www.777doc.com/doc-4406168 .html